Honda Navi with Knobby Tires
Knobby tires are a type of off-road tire designed with a rugged tread pattern that gives it superior grip on loose surfaces. The tread pattern helps the tire to dig into the surface and provide better traction than a conventional tire. This makes it ideal for use in off-road applications such as Honda Navi motorcycles. Knobby tires also provide additional shock absorption, making them great for navigating rough terrain.

How to Get the Right Type of Knobby Tire for your Honda Navi
When selecting knobby tires for your Honda Navi, there are several things you should consider before making a purchase. For starters, make sure that the size is compatible with your bikes frame size and wheel diameter so that they will fit properly. You should also check that the tread pattern is suited to the type of terrain you will be riding in some knobbies are better suited for sand or mud while others are better suited for hard packed dirt surfaces or rocks. Lastly, take note of any speed rating or load capacity information indicated on the sidewall of the tire this will help ensure that you get the right type of tire for your needs.
